Shares of NextEra Energy Inc. $(NEE)$ slid 1.37% to $66.35 Thursday, on what proved to be an all-around favorable trading session for the stock market, with the S&P 500 Index rising 2.03% to 5,484.77 and the Dow Jones Industrial Average rising 1.23% to 40,093.40.
The stock's fall snapped a two-day winning streak.
NextEra Energy Inc. closed 22.94% short of its 52-week high of $86.10, which the company reached on October 3rd.
The stock underperformed when compared to some of its competitors Thursday, as Southern Co. $(SO)$ fell 0.09% to $91.05, Dominion Energy Inc. $(D)$ rose 0.04% to $53.35, and American Electric Power Co. Inc. $(AEP)$ fell 0.30% to $106.70.
Trading volume (13.7 M) eclipsed its 50-day average volume of 12.6 M.
